In my opinion, games are learned more by intentional learning mechanisms rather than
unintentional learning. According to the textbook, intentional leaning happens when “consumers
set out to specifically learn information devoted to a certain subject.” On the other hand,
unintentional learning occurs “when behavior is modified through a consumer stimulus
interaction without a cognitive effort to understand a stimulus”. Before the customers start to
play game, they are required to read instructions to learn how to play the game. Generally, the
instructions are long and boring, but users make cognitive efforts to understand them in order to
enjoy the game. Therefore, games are learned by intentional learning mechanisms.
